用于android的facebook sdk入门

时间:2013-07-14 15:03:59

标签: android facebook bundle android-fragmentactivity android-support-library

我已经完成了Facebook开发人员支持的“Facebook SDK for Android入门”的第3步,这是Sample目录中的代码:

package com.facebook.samples.profilepicture;

import android.os.Bundle;
import android.support.v4.app.FragmentActivity;

public class ProfilePictureSampleActivity extends FragmentActivity {
    @Override
    public void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.activity_profile_picture_sample);
    }
}

当我尝试运行ProfilePictureSample时,会出现以下错误:

  • “无法解析导入android.os.Bundle”
  • “android.app.Activity类型无法解析。它是间接的 从必需的.class文件“
  • 引用
  • “ProfilePictureSampleActivity类型的层次结构是 不一致“

那我怎么解决它们呢?这很奇怪,因为如果我使用android.os.Bundle构建一个简单的活动项目就可以了。

1 个答案:

答案 0 :(得分:0)

可能问题是这个代码请求的应用程序的持有者api版本因为我认为android.os.Bundle是用于android sdk的api 17。所以可以通过转到“android sdk Manager”并下载所请求api的版本来解决。